I'd recommend Kidspace in Pasadena, but I do not know if they have reopened yet, as they are building a new "Space" The last I had heard they were slated to re-open in early 2004.

My daughter also loved (still does at 21) Travel Town at Griffith Park. If he likes trains, this is great place to play on real live choo-choos, and you catch a train ride and then ride the miniature train at L.A. Live Steamers. It is also not far from the Pony Rides and Carousel, all in Griffith Park.

Griffith Park, the zoo there, and Travel Town are all great places for a 4 year old and you too. It's such a great park. They have pony rides both at Travel Town and right off Los Feliz (where there's also a wonderful train ride). Further in, you can stop at the old Merry Go Round, beautifully restored about 15 years ago.

Has he been to Knotts Berry Farm? 4 year olds just love the train there, as well as the pony & petting zoo. They have a whole little ride area just for smaller kids, and supermarkets usually have discount tickets.

Santa Monica Pier for the beautiful wooden carousel horses and the pier attractions like a big Ferris wheel and skeeball. He won't be able to ride all the rides but he'll love the ones he can. The people who run the carnival attractions usually "let" my 3 year old win something so she LOVES it. And of course, there's this big sand box adjacent called the SM Beach!
